Team News: Philipp Lahm only on Bayern Munich bench

Lahm only on Bayern bench

Philipp Lahm is back in the Bayern Munich squad for their Champions League last-16 second leg against Shakhtar Donetsk, but only as a substitute.

The Bayern captain has not played since November because of a broken ankle and had hoped to make his return as a starter at the Allianz Arena this evening.

Robert Lewandowski is recalled to play up front in an attacking Munich side which is missing the suspended Xabi Alonso, sent off in the 0-0 first-leg draw a fortnight ago.

Bastian Schweinsteiger will be the sole man protecting a defence which sees Dante and Juan Bernat drop out from the 3-1 victory over Hannover on Saturday.

Shakhtar make just one change from their first-leg lineup as Fernando replaces Taras Stepanenko in midfield.

Tournament top scorer Luiz Adriano will lead the line for the Ukrainians, but his Brazilian counterpart Bernard is unavailable.

Bayern: Neuer; Rafinha, Boateng, Badstuber, Alaba; Schweinsteiger, Gotze; Ribery, Muller, Robben; Lewandowski

Shakhtar: Pyatov, Srna, Kucher, Rakitskiy, Shevchuk, Fred, Stepanenko, Costa, Teixeira, Taison, Adriano
